CGHS teacher receives national honor for impact on culinary industry

Susanne Ebacher-Grier

(August 14, 2022) - Center Grove High School teacher and chef Susanne Ebacher-Grier was awarded the Presidential Medallion by the America Culinary Foundation (ACF) in July. The honor is the highest award given by the ACF and recognizes the recipient's outstanding representation of the ACF fundamental principles, including superior strength of character and continued contributions to ACF and/or the culinary industry as a whole.

"When I would see the Presidential Medallion awarded, it became a goal. Was I always cognizant of it – no. I just continued to serve the chapters I belonged to and then serve the Greater Indianapolis Chapter with a giving heart, mentorship and a passion for the hospitality industry," Grier told the culinary magazine Cuvée"Receiving this award is an accumulation of hard work and unknown wins shared with many. What makes me emotional about this is thinking about my Dad. He would have been beyond proud of me being a person of integrity and wanting to do the right thing while utilizing my culinary talents."

Grier teaches more than 350 students as part of the CGHS Culinary Pathway program.
